Transaction 20f7844b9f359875645adea113701c10740a950412254bc370be1dff98aa5afb
2 Input
2 Outputs
- 20f7844b9f359875645adea113701c10740a950412254bc370be1dff98aa5afb:0
- 20f7844b9f359875645adea113701c10740a950412254bc370be1dff98aa5afb:1
value 561868900
address 1LRxwKG5XFxp9z5KQS4eKduHF6gC756PWS
value 23000000
address 1GQFSGMinJ1KCV6HLPGXzZ8wPmdyhYr6hw